Hi there, can someone comment on usually how long it takes to build an image?  I know there are several factors at play - but what are some times people have gotten in making an SD card image with a clean build.

 

Just trying to set expectations - I am on a quad core 1.5GZ machine with 8 gigs of ram on SSD.

starting fresh without cache.. probably an hourish for that setup..... once you have toolchain and rootfs cache... more like 15 minutes

got these times with a Core2Duo 2.4GHz, 8GB Ram but with a normal 7200rpm HDD

 

Image for a - to the cache - new device around 60-75 minutes.

for a device in cache around 15-25 minutes.

Building CLI image on 28x Xeon 2G/128GB/NvME with kernel and u-boot recompilation:

[ o.k. ] Done building [ /home/igorp/build/output/images/Armbian_5.89_Lime2_Debian_buster_next_4.19.50.img ]
[ o.k. ] Runtime [ 13 min ]

Sometimes it takes an insane amount of time to download the toolchains and rootfs when you run the script for the first time, keep that in mind. 


USE_TORRENT="yes" might help in both cases. I always get maxed out download speed.
